Axon Virtual PBX

Axon is a virtual IP PBX for Windows designed to manage phone calls in a business or call center environment. This software works as a fully featured telephone switch connecting to phone lines and extensions using stateoftheart VoIP technology, offering all the normal features of a traditional PBX routing all calls within a business.

Lumen Contact Center

CenturyLink© Contact Center Solutions offer cloud- and network-based services that provide flexibility, scalability, and low TCO, as well as a robust feature-functionality set that delivers an excellent customer experience. Call Routing: Intelligent Pre-Route (IPR) Reduce call transfers and costly reroutes with Intelligent Pre-Route (IPR), a CenturyLink network-hosted application that integrates with Cisco Intelligent Call Manager (ICM). IPR routes calls to the appropriate destination directly from the Toll Free Network. IPR communicates with premise-based call center platforms to determine the location, group, or individual best available to handle incoming calls. Call Routing: Interaction Routing Improve sales and services while lowering contact center costs with Interaction Routing, a network-based contact-center solution that includes inbound ACD routing, outbound dialing, web-contact transaction routing, workforce management, and detailed reporting. IVR: Hosted IVR Improve your customers' experience with Hosted IVR, a scalable, flexible platform that gives you the ability to direct calls according to customer need and agent availability. IVR: EZ Route Improve business efficiency and customer satisfaction with EZ Route, CenturyLink's network-based, self-help, IVR application that provides contact-center functionality, such as menu routing, database routing, intelligent call processing, and links to custom applications. IVR: On Demand IVR Simplify application management with On-Demand IVR, a cloud-based application that's delivered to you as a service. Use the simple GUI to develop call routing applications without the time or money required for software development. Outbound Notification: Notify Improve your customers' experience with Notify, an outbound notification service that allows you to deliver multi-media content to a variety of end-point devices. Pre-defined applications are available to meet standard business needs such as appointment reminders, while custom applications let you create more complex applications to meet unique needs.

Netstratum Communication Suite

NCS (Netstratum Communication Suite) is an operator-grade UCaaS and hosted PBX platform built for telecom operators, resellers, and MSPs. Delivered as a fully white-labelled, multi-tenant solution, NCS enables service providers to launch and manage their own branded communication services — including cloud telephony, softphone, unified messaging, contact centre, SIP trunking, auto dialling- under a single platform. With live operator deployments across the US, UK, and Africa, and over 25 years of telecoms expertise behind it, NCS is purpose-built for partners who need carrier-grade reliability, deep customisation, and a platform that scales with their customer base.
